Transaction 22a44aae264daaf6943cb83dbc5d663bbdc94f721f6bce529af9a8fe63b9a668

3 Input
2 Outputs
  • 22a44aae264daaf6943cb83dbc5d663bbdc94f721f6bce529af9a8fe63b9a668:0
  • value  1022173
    address  3CNJU911d5DG1qAtwXa6X3WrbSswN845fb
  • 22a44aae264daaf6943cb83dbc5d663bbdc94f721f6bce529af9a8fe63b9a668:1
  • value  586856
    address  19YMR1oxv5H1EtZwr1huFdTGu2nVxpp3JW